Output 50bff2e832230fe79c8e5c5fa1bd109c2ecc2b6d9953bbd7b984d5556c6a7243:1

value
1592194
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b76589badcba658e73a979439eccdcb70a25f3c OP_EQUALVERIFY OP_CHECKSIG
address
13WD21idWu53aM7PDcAnxFeXyxrwkpiKBU
transaction
50bff2e832230fe79c8e5c5fa1bd109c2ecc2b6d9953bbd7b984d5556c6a7243
spent
true